POSITION OVERVIEW Conferences, in-person and online meetings and education are core interrelated functions for PQA, as we bring the industry together to develop, learn about and share best practices for quality strategies, quality measures, related tools and supporting research. The Education and Events Manager supports the delivery of PQA's convening and education activities, including but not limited to the annual meeting, leadership summit, webinars and other online events, continuing education programs, workshops, forums and staff meetings. The manager provides project management and administrative support for PQA's activities and serves as a liaison for programmatic faculty, workshop participants and internal and external speakers for PQA's meetings and events. The manager also contributes to the evaluation of educational and convening activities. The manager reports to the Director of Education and works collaboratively with staff across the organization. The ideal candidate is organized, energetic, forward-thinking and creative. This position requires an individual who can work efficiently on several projects simultaneously, is results-oriented, has prioritization skills and can adapt to a fast-paced, deadline-driven and changing environment. QUALIFICATIONS & EXPERIENCE A minimum of 2-3 years of full-time related experience in event, meeting or professional educational program support or office administration. Bachelor's degree required. A bachelor's degree in a healthcare-related field is a plus. Association management experience preferred. Health care association or project management experience is a plus. Excellent written and oral communication skills. Outstanding customer service skills. Ability to manage multiple projects and priorities, to work independently and in teams, proactively and directed. Self-starter, able to anticipate needs and take initiative. Fast learner, flexible and adaptable. Computer proficiency, including Microsoft Office Suite and Zoom. Experience with or willingness to learn new systems, such as association management systems and websites Experience assessing programs, developing reports and recommendations is preferred.
